PRODUCT SPECIFICATIONS
Standard impedance values 1-1/2%, 2, 3%, 4%, 5% available
Impedance basis Reactor fundamental current rating
Service Factor
(Continuous)
Reactors rated 1 to 750 Amps 150% of fundamental rating
Reactors rated above 750 Amps 125% of fundamental rating minimum
Note: Select reactor based on fundamental current
rating
Overload Rating 200% of fundamental for 30 minutes
300% of fundamental for 1 minute
Maximum system voltage 600 Volts (units with terminal blocks)
690 Volts (units with box lugs or tab terminals)
Maximum switching frequency 20 KHz
Insulation system Class N (200° C)
Temperature rise 135° C (average)
Ambient temperature Full load:
-40 to 50° C Open
-40 to 45° C Enclosed
-40 to 90° C Storage
Altitude (maximum) 1000 meters
Fundamental frequency
Line or Load 50/60 Hz
Approvals: CE, UL-508, CSA C22.2
Inductance curve (typical) 100% at 100% current
100% at 150% current
50% at 350% current (minimum)
Inductance tolerance +/- 10%
Impregnation: High Bond Strength “Solvent less” Epoxy, 200° C
UL94HB recognized
Dielectric Strength 3000 volts rms (4243 volts peak)
dv/dt Protection Meets NEMA MG-1, part 31 (same as inverter duty
motors)
Protection: Open reactors with terminal blocks through 45 amps
meet IP20
